What Are The Areas Of Self Esteem / Self Concept?
• The areas are :– Physical : how you feel about your body and health.– Emotional : how you feel about your feelings and how you express
them.– Social : how you feel about your ability to get along with others.– Intellectual : how you feel about your ability to think and solve
problems.– Spiritual : how you feel about your religious beliefs or your place in
the “big picture.”

How To Promote Self Esteem
• Encourage decision making• Praise positive behaviors• Follow the child’s lead• Accept that it is normal to have disappointments• Separate the child from the failure• Show affection
